Output 81bece2698a1c54ecd3b87a9439a8ea17b238cdf000d30d581ca5aced8f79937:2

value
138085
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7bf4b2d28c85529da7451d4acba7a004ad2b2b8a OP_EQUAL
address
3CzSB6CfjumsCGPsUG7f3Ubfkay7nDmwqz
transaction
81bece2698a1c54ecd3b87a9439a8ea17b238cdf000d30d581ca5aced8f79937
spent
true